## Runbook: Squatwatch Scanner

Squatwatch scans every plugin submitted to the Brindlehook registry for typo-squatting against existing package names. If your plugin is flagged, the publish step halts and a report lands in your submission log. False positives can be appealed by rerunning the scan with the `--claim-owner` flag. Plugin authors invoking the scanner directly must call the internal Squatwatch endpoint and authenticate with the key below.

service key, fawip-bajef: kto11_Qt5wZK9vdNC

## Runbook: Fee Rules Engine (Tollwhistle)

Hey, new folks — Tollwhistle is the rules engine that computes shipping fees for every Quindle order. Rules are evaluated top-down; first match wins, so ordering matters a lot. If fees look wrong, check the rule cache refresh first, since stale rules cause 90% of incidents. Restarting the evaluator is safe and takes about ten seconds. Before you restart anything, confirm the runtime matches the expected configuration, which is as follows.

settings of faweg-tahop:
ISTAX_PIN=8134
ISTAX_METRICS_HOST=metrics.istax.tolvaqcorp.internal
ISTAX_LOG_LEVEL=debug
ISTAX_TENANT=caseth

False-positive rate is contractually capped at 1%, rebuilt nightly from the Tandrel ingest pipeline. For the security review: the filter holds hashed keys only, no values, and is memory-resident in the Verano region cluster. Deletion requests bypass the filter and hit the store directly, so tombstones are authoritative. Vendor attestation reports are refreshed quarterly. Requests for the latest attestation bundle should be sent to the address below.

alerts address for bafog-tawep: ulavan_sorwyn_fraax@kelviworks.local

First-aid room, Level 2, Alder Wing. Visitors needing treatment must be escorted by a staff member at all times. Log all visitor incidents in the red binder at the facilities desk before end of shift. Do not leave visitors unattended in the room; supplies are audited monthly. Cot and defibrillator are for trained responders only. Room stays locked when not in use. Restock requests go through the facilities desk. The keypad by the door accepts the standard access code:

door code, yagap-bahof: bdg-O-05